Step-by-Step Instructions
- Trim the base of the enoki mushrooms to separate them gently. Slice into 1/4 inch layers for even cooking.
- Heat enough neutral oil in a heavy-bottomed pot to 375°F (190°C). Use a thermometer to ensure accuracy.
- In a bowl, combine the dry ingredients for the batter and whisk in cold sparkling water until smooth.
- Dip each cluster of mushrooms into the batter ensuring they are well-coated, allowing excess to drip off.
- Carefully lower mushrooms into hot oil and fry for 1-2 minutes until golden brown, flipping occasionally.
- Drain on a wire rack and season lightly with salt and furikake if desired. Serve warm with dipping sauces.
